Set Up a Safe Winter Work Area

A garage, a basement corner, or a spare room can host most of these projects, but the space needs the same safety basics a job site gets. Winter work areas fail in predictable ways: poor light, no ventilation, and cold surfaces that slow paint and adhesive curing.

Choose the Right Indoor Space

Pick a spot with a solid work surface, access to power, and enough clearance to move around a sheet of plywood. A basement offers stable temperatures; a garage offers more room but can drop below the minimum curing temperature for paints and glues. A thermometer on the wall removes the guesswork.

Lighting, Power, and Ventilation

Task lighting matters more indoors because shadows hide sanding defects and paint lines. Extension cords should carry a rating for the load; a 15-amp circuit handles most hobby tools, but a table saw and a shop vacuum should not share one outlet. When solvents or finishes are in use, open a window or run a fan that exhausts outdoors.

Stay Safe on Slippery Ground

The trip between the house and a detached garage or shed becomes a real hazard in winter. Ice forms on steps, driveways, and walkways overnight, and a loaded tool bag makes a fall harder to catch. Winterize the House Before You Build

Indoor projects run smoother in a house that is sealed, warm, and dry. Drafts make paint cure unevenly, a cold house strains the furnace, and high humidity delays drying. Handle the envelope first, then start the fun part.

Seal Drafts and Check the Heating System

Walk the perimeter with a flashlight and feel for air movement at windows, doors, and utility penetrations. Weather stripping and door sweeps are cheap, quick fixes that usually pay for themselves in a single heating season.

Window and Door Seals

Single-pane windows and older doors leak the most air. Foam tape, silicone caulk, and a fresh sweep close most gaps; for storm windows, use removable caulk so they still open in spring.

Build Storage Cubes: A Beginner Carpentry Project

Storage cubes are the project contractors most often suggest to beginners. They are small, so they fit in any spare indoor area, and they teach measuring, cutting, and assembling while producing something the house actually needs. A first cube takes about two hours with a circular saw.

Materials and a Cut List

One cube uses a single sheet of 3/4 in plywood plus a thin back panel. The cut list below scales up if you are building a stack of four or six cubes for a closet or a mudroom, and a sheet of 4 x 8 ft plywood yields the pieces for two cubes with little waste.

ComponentMaterialQuantityPurpose
Top and bottom panels3/4 in plywood2Frame the cube
Side panels3/4 in plywood2Carry the vertical load
Back panel1/4 in plywood1Keep contents from falling through
Edge bandingIron-on veneer8 stripsCover raw plywood edges

Cutting Plywood Indoors

Plywood dust is fine and it travels. Cut outside when you can, or set up a cutting station near a window with a shop vacuum on the saw. Masking tape along the cut line reduces splintering on the veneer face, and a straightedge guide turns a circular saw into a panel saw for long cuts.

Assemble the Cubes

Assembly goes fastest with pocket holes or pilot holes, both of which prevent the plywood from splitting near the edge.

  1. Cut panels to size and sand every edge with 120-grit paper
  2. Drill pocket holes or pilot holes in the joint locations
  3. Apply wood glue, clamp the frame, and check the diagonals
  4. Drive the screws and re-check squareness with a tape measure
  5. Attach the back panel, then iron on the edge banding

Keep Tools and Materials in Shape Through Winter

Cold weather changes how tools behave. Batteries lose capacity, lubricants thicken, and adhesives separate. A few habits keep everything ready for the next session instead of a trip to the hardware store.

Batteries and Lubricants

Lithium-ion batteries should live indoors when temperatures drop below freezing; charging a cold pack shortens its service life. Keep blades and bits lightly oiled so moisture does not pit the steel, and store router and saw bits in a sealed box with a desiccant pack.

Store Adhesives and Paints Warm

Latex paint and wood glue degrade after freeze-thaw cycles, even when the cans look fine. Store them in a heated closet rather than an unheated garage, and write the date on the lid so you know what is still usable.

Painting Baseboards and Trim

Baseboards demand more control than walls. Painting trim takes careful brushwork with longer strokes and even pressure, and the skill transfers to doors, window casings, and crown molding. Tape the floor line, use a quality angled brush, and keep a wet edge so lap marks do not form between coats.

Electrical, Plumbing, and Hardware Upgrades

USB outlets and dimmers follow the same shutdown-and-verify sequence: kill the breaker, test the circuit, and match the wire colors. Plumbing basics worth learning include replacing a faucet washer and installing a compression shutoff valve. Foundation and Drainage Checks During Winter

While the indoor projects keep you busy, the parts of the house you cannot see still need attention. Basements and crawl spaces reveal moisture problems that winter makes worse, and catching them in January is cheaper than discovering them at a spring inspection.

Check the Basement and Crawl Space

Look for efflorescence on foundation walls, standing water near floor drains, and frost on exposed pipes. Confirm the sump pump cycles on and off, and pour a bucket of water into the pit to watch it drain. A basement that stays dry through January usually stays dry all year, which protects stored goods, framing, and the indoor projects themselves.

Watch for Freeze-Ups
